The Coronado Project Archaeological Investigations: A Description of Lithic Collections from the Railroad and Transmission Line Corridors (1984)
During 1974-1978, the Museum of Northern Arizona conducted an extensive archaeological mitigation program for the Salt River Project prior to the construction of the Coronado Generating Plant near St. Johns, Arizona, and its energy corridors, the Coronado-Silver King Transmission Line and the Coronado Coal Haul Railroad. VAFB-2020-07: Identification of Historic Properties and Assessment of Effects, Vandenberg Dunes Golf Course Project, Vandenberg Air Force Base, Santa Barbara County, California (2020)
This document is a Section 106 report for the identification and assessment of effects for archaeological resources that are associated with the Vandenberg Dunes Golf Course Project. Vandenberg AFB proposes to enter into an Enhanced Use Lease with MLK Consulting, LLC to develop 1,273 acres for recreational golf. VAFB-2020-37: Cultural Resource Investigations to Support Compliance with Section 106 of the National Historic Preservation Act for Development of the Vandenberg Dunes Golf Courses on Vandenberg Air Force Base, Santa Barbara County, California (2017-G) (2020)
Vandenberg Air Force Base (AFB) proposes to enter into an Enhanced Use Lease with MLK Consulting, LLC (MLK) wherein MLK would develop approximately 1,273 acres to include multiple golf courses and supporting services. The proposed development, to be known as the Vandenberg Dunes Golf Courses, would subsume the existing 250-acre Marshallia Ranch Golf Course and substantially upgrade it to ultimately include five separate golf courses and associated facilities and infrastructure.
